How to use
To exploit the full potential of the
MADNESS Ulti Ned Worm, rig it on a Ned-style weighted head, choosing a weight adapted to depth, current and wind. The goal is to maintain constant contact with the bottom while preserving a slow, controlled animation.
Cast your rig, let it fall to the bottom, then control the line. You can then:
- Keep it under tension on the fall for a controlled, natural presentation.
- Drag it slowly along the bottom with the rod low to follow irregularities and trigger reaction bites.
- Twitch it on the spot with small rod-tip movements to make the worm vibrate without moving it several meters.
Don’t hesitate to include long pauses: the worm’s buoyancy makes it particularly attractive when the bait remains motionless, merely animated by micro-movements of the line or the current.
This
floating softbait for perch, zander, black bass and sea bass can be used with light to medium rods with a sensitive action to feel the slightest bite and the bait’s behavior on the bottom. Use a relatively thin, discreet line to fully exploit its potential in clear waters and highly pressured areas.
